Open Microsoft Excel and load your Excel file. Go to the File menu > Export > Create PDF/XPS. Click the Publish button once you're all done with that. Open the exported PDF into your preferred PDF viewer.
There are two ways you can convert an Excel file to a PDF. The first is to save it as a PDF file directly to do this, press File > Save As and ensure that PDF is selected under the Save as type drop-down menu. Press Save once you're ready.
Open a workbook. On the File tab, click Save As. Click Browse. Select PDF from the drop-down list. Click Options. You can publish a selection, active sheet or entire workbook. Click OK and then Click Save.
